Make sure you're not approaching him unless he's vulnerable. I'm sure you are approaching poorly which happens commonly under stress. You need to let him come to you, and react to his actions instead of the other way around. Next time you play make sure you are forcing him to come to you and throw out attacks, then see how his play style differs when you play without approaching.

Sonic isn't a fun character to fight. Still, I would recommend a few things. Don't play against CPUs. Even though they're better than CPUs in previous games, they're not going to adapt like a human player. You're better off playing against your classmate or someone else you can play in person. If not, play on For Glory. Don't worry about losing. That's not to say don't try or don't care about winning. Do try to win.

Nervousness will come and go, but when your nervousness goes away, you'll perform better. I'd say find time to play against this classmate. Play him as often as you can. You'll pick up what he does and improve. Whether you win or lose, you'll always leave with experience. And good for you on trying to get videos. Watch those, see what you did right and what you did wrong. See what your classmate did right and wrong. Then find ways to get around his strategies. Have fun.
